User review spotlight: Carmageddon (DOS). Released in 1997.

AlfaSystem Co., Ltd.


AlfaSystem is a Japanese software developer located in Kumamoto, Japan. The company was founded in January 1988. Its president is Tetsuya Sasaki. They have developed a number of games in different genres for various console system, among them Castle of Shikigami series.

Contributed by אולג 小奥 (171813) on May 07, 2012.